    The Norwegian Refugee Council (NRC) is a non-governmental, humanitarian organization with 60 years of experience in helping to create a safer and more dignified life for refugees and internally displaced people. NRC advocates for the rights of displaced populations and offers assistance within the shelter, education, emergency food security, legal assistance, and water,sanitation and hygiene sectors. The Norwegian Refugee Council has approximately 5000 committed and competent employees involved in projects across four continents. In addition, NRC runs one of the world’s largest standby rosters -NORCAP, with 650 professionals, ready to be deployed on 72 hours notice when a crisis occurs

    Regional Director East and Southern Africa

    What you will do

    • People leadership responsibilities (performance management, workforce planning, recruitment, induction, duty of care, resource and budget management, etc.)
    • Strategic direction priorities development.
    • Country strategies and compliance approval against direction, policies, and standards.
    • Duty of care. Promoting a safety, security, and risk management culture.
    • Accountability, ethics, and humanitarian principles promotion.
    • Advocacy and NRC representation nationally, regionally, and internationally.
    • Fundraising for programme and business development. Maintenance and development of partner and donor relations. 
    • Emergency assessment and response oversight.
    • Contextual understanding, ideas, and actions contribution and engagement.

    What you will bring

    • Senior leadership experience.
    • Humanitarian/recovery/emergency response context experience.
    • International humanitarian community connections.
    • Representation track record across various levels.
    • Change management experience.
    • Start-up experience is an added advantage. 
    • East and Southern Africa Region context exposure and knowledge.
    • Complex and volatile context exposure.
    • English fluency, both written and verbal.
